B.B. King and I
A young drummer travels from the heartland of America to Hollywood in pursuit of his musical destiny. After attending a B.B. King concert in 1980, the drummer strikes up a friendship with the blues legend that endures for 30 years, culminating with him gifting King with a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ame.

babyteeth
When seriously ill teenager Milla falls madly in love with smalltime drug dealer Moses, it’s her parents’ worst nightmare. But as Milla’s first brush with love brings her a new lust for life, things get messy and traditional morals go out the window. Milla soon shows everyone in her orbit – her parents, Moses, a sensitive music teacher, a budding child violinist, and a disarmingly honest, pregnant neighbour – how to live like you have nothing to lose. What might have been a disaster for the Finlay family instead leads to letting go and finding grace in the glorious chaos of life.

Bad Education
Inspired by a school district scandal on Long Island, Bad Education deals with the public and private lives of the superintendent Frank Tassone (Hugh Jackman), assistant/office coordinator Pam Gluckin (Allison Janney), and school board president Bob Spicer (Ray Romano). Slowly we see things start to unravel revealing Frank's double life, including a fling with a former pupil. In addition, Pam has been using the Official office credit card for more than school business.
